Granville, Ohio. Lot of 4 notes (uncut sheet of 4), 186x (ca.1960-70’s), $1-1-1-2, (OH-231-G-2; G-4). Modern Progress “Proprietary Proofs”. All are missing the borders and undertints, The $1 notes have an eagle in the middle, young woman blowing on a dandelion on lower right and young girl on lower left; the $2 note has young woman on lower left, man with contraption in middle and Native American Indian maiden on lower right. Black printing without underprint printed on thin white card, the borders are missing since they were printed in the underprint color. Choice to Gem Uncirculated condition. ABNC. Archival “Proprietary” proofs rarely seen in sheet form. Nashville, Tennessee. Lot of 4 notes (uncut sheet of 4), 18xx (ca.1960-70’s), $50-50-100-100, (TN-210-50Ba; TN-210-100Ba) Modern “Proprietary Proofs”. The $50 proofs have the well known polar bear attacking boat vignette and the $100 notes have mules pulling wagon filled with cotton. Black printing with no underprints printed on thin white card, Uncirculated condition. ABNC. Archival “Proprietary” proofs rarely seen in sheet form.
